1. A cell biologist is studying the body's first line of defense against pathogens. Which characteristic
best distinguishes innate immunity from adaptive immunity?


A) It responds immediately and lacks specificity


B) It develops memory after initial exposure


C) It relies on B and T lymphocytes for antigen recognition


D) It requires clonal expansion for effective response


Correct Answer: It responds immediately and lacks specificity


Rationale: Innate immunity provides immediate, non-specific protection against pathogens. Adaptive
immunity is characterized by antigen specificity, immunological memory, and clonal expansion
involving B and T lymphocytes, making those options incorrect descriptions of innate immunity.


2. A researcher is examining the mechanisms by which the innate immune system recognizes
conserved microbial structures. Which receptors are primarily responsible for this recognition?


A) T cell receptors


B) B cell receptors


C) Toll-like receptors


D) Cytokine receptors

,Correct Answer: Toll-like receptors


Rationale: Toll-like receptors (TLRs) are pattern recognition receptors that detect conserved microbial
motifs known as pathogen-associated molecular patterns (PAMPs). T cell and B cell receptors are
components of adaptive immunity, and cytokine receptors bind signaling molecules, making them
incorrect.


3. During an infection, a specific cytokine is released that stimulates inflammation, fever, and liver
production of acute-phase proteins. Which cytokine profile is responsible for these effects?


A) IL-4 and IL-5


B) TNF-α, IL-1, and IL-6


C) IFN-γ and TGF-β


D) IL-10 and IL-12


Correct Answer: TNF-α, IL-1, and IL-6


Rationale: TNF-α, IL-1, and IL-6 are key pro-inflammatory cytokines that initiate fever and the acute-
phase response. IL-4 and IL-5 drive allergic responses, IFN-γ activates macrophages, TGF-β is
immunosuppressive, and IL-10 is anti-inflammatory, making them incorrect.


4. Which innate immune cells are the first to arrive at an infection site and perform phagocytosis?


A) Macrophages


B) Dendritic cells


C) Neutrophils

, D) Natural killer cells


Correct Answer: Neutrophils


Rationale: Neutrophils are the earliest responders to infection, quickly engulfing and destroying
pathogens. Macrophages arrive later, dendritic cells are antigen-presenting cells, and natural killer
cells target infected cells, making them incorrect for this early phagocytic role.


5. Which cytokines are key for antiviral defense in innate immunity?


A) IL-4 and IL-5


B) IFN-α and IFN-β


C) TNF-α and IL-1


D) IL-10 and IL-12


Correct Answer: IFN-α and IFN-β


Rationale: Type I interferons (α, β) inhibit viral replication and activate NK cells, making them central
in antiviral defense. IL-4 and IL-5 drive allergic responses, TNF-α and IL-1 mediate inflammation, and
IL-10 is anti-inflammatory, making them incorrect.
